Subject: [PATCH 08/17] UAPI: Guard linux/sound.h
Date: Tue, 13 Dec 2011 10:04:04 +0000	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<1323770653-19177-9-git-send-email-dhowells@redhat.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<1323770653-19177-1-git-send-email-dhowells@redhat.com>

Place reinclusion guards on linux/sound.h otherwise the UAPI splitter script
won't insert a #include to make the kernel header include the UAPI header.

Signed-off-by: David Howells <dhowells@redhat.com>
---
 include/linux/sound.h |    4 ++++
 1 files changed, 4 insertions(+), 0 deletions(-)

diff --git a/include/linux/sound.h b/include/linux/sound.h
index 44dcf05..fae20ba 100644
--- a/include/linux/sound.h
+++ b/include/linux/sound.h
@@ -1,3 +1,5 @@
+#ifndef _LINUX_SOUND_H
+#define _LINUX_SOUND_H
 
 /*
  * Minor numbers for the sound driver.
@@ -42,3 +44,5 @@ extern void unregister_sound_mixer(int unit);
 extern void unregister_sound_midi(int unit);
 extern void unregister_sound_dsp(int unit);
 #endif /* __KERNEL__ */
+
+#endif /* _LINUX_SOUND_H */
